Former Rep. Beto ORourke (Texas) called on his fellow Democrats to fight fire with fire as Republicans in his state move forward with an effort to alter Texass congressional district lines ahead of the 2026 midterm elections. In an interview on CNNs State of the Union, ORourke said Democrats need to start playing the same game as Republicans and stop worrying only about doing what is right.
I think its time that we match fire with fire. I think Democrats in the past too often have been more concerned with being right than being in power. And we have seen Republicans only care about being in power, regardless of what is right, ORourke said in the interview.
In a rare mid-decade redistricting effort, Texas state lawmakers are expected to consider new congressional lines during a special session of the Texas Legislature, which GOP Gov. Greg Abbott called. The effort to redraw the Texas map has been made at the request of President Trump, who aims to bolster the GOPs slim House majority to ensure that Republicans maintain control of the lower chamber during his final two years of his second term.
In a call to Texas Republicans on Tuesday morning, the president urged lawmakers to draw the districts in a way that would allow Republicans to flip five Democratic seats to the GOP.
